Senior Python Developer

We are inviting a Senior Python Developer to create secure, scalable backend services with Python and contribute to an engineering team focused on quality delivery. You will help integrate AI/LLM features, work with Django/Flask stacks, and support continuous improvement—apply today. Responsibilities Create and maintain scalable backend architectures and services Work with multidisciplinary teams to deliver high-quality software products Join code review cycles and provide feedback to uphold coding standards Boost application efficiency and troubleshoot technical challenges Manage connections and integrations with third-party APIs and services Prepare and maintain thorough technical documentation for new and existing features Follow and promote best practices across all stages of software development Assist in continuously improving team workflows and technical expertise Requirements 3 years of relevant professional experience in software engineering Strong knowledge of Python for building and supporting applications Experience integrating AI or Large Language Models (LLM) into development projects Solid expertise in database architecture, management, and optimization Proficiency using Git for source control and collaborative workflows Practical experience with Python web frameworks like Django or Flask Understanding of Python web server configuration and deployment Awareness of core security principles and how to apply them in software projects Experience delivering user authentication and authorization implementations Familiarity with Agile or Scrum software development methodologies Excellent English communication skills (B2+ Upper-Intermediate) in both speaking and writing

Similar jobs